In this video, we’ll introduce basic concepts such as intent schemas, utterances, and the Alexa communication paradigm. You’ll learn how to tunnel a local application using ngrok over HTTPS, and how to connect Alexa to a local development environment. You will construct a simple skill called Hello, World and learn how the above concepts work and play together.
